標題:
2025/01/11 課堂重點
[打印本頁]
作者:
方浩葦
時間:
2025-1-10 18:40
標題:
2025/01/11 課堂重點
本帖最後由 方浩葦 於 2025-1-11 15:29 編輯
上課錄影連結
[上課進度]
測驗-603
講解-a006
講解-a043
觀念題:
考古題:
10510 - 07
10510 - 08
10510 - 09
練習題:
10510 - 07
10510 - 08
10510 - 09
實作題:
10503 - 2
10503 - 3
10503 - 4
[回家作業]
實作題 10503 - 1
[作業檢查]
kitajudge回復
[下次考試]
601
[備註]
提早做完的同學去練題目:
程式練習題清單
作者:
許浩浩
時間:
2025-1-18 12:46
#include<bits/stdc++.h>
using namespace std;
int n;
int main()
{
cin>>n;
int data[n];
for(int i=0;i<n;i++)
cin>>data[i];
sort(data,data+n);
for(int i=0;i<n;i++)
{
cout<<data[i]<<" ";
}
cout<<endl;
if(data[0]>=60)
{
cout<<"best case"<<"\n";
for(int i=0;i<n;i++)
{
if(data[i]>=60)
{
cout<<data[i];
break;
}
}
}
else if(data[n-1]<60)
{
cout<<data[n-1]<<endl;
cout<<"worst case";
}
else
{
for(int i=0;i<n;i++)
{
if(data[i]>=60)
{
cout<<data[i-1]<<"\n"<<data[i];
break;
}
}
}
}
複製代碼
作者:
江家同
時間:
2025-1-18 14:34
#include<bits/stdc++.h>
using namespace std;
int main()
{
int n;
cin>>n;
int point[n];
for(int i=0;i<n;i++)
cin>>point[i];
sort(point,point+n);
int l=-1,h=101;
for(int i=0;i<n;i++)
{
if(i==n-1)
cout<<point[i]<<endl;
else
cout<<point[i]<<" ";
if(point[i]<60)
l=max(l,point[i]);
else
h=min(h,point[i]);
}
if(l>=0)
cout<<l<<endl;
else
cout<<"best case";
if(h<=100)
cout<<h<<endl;
else
cout<<"worst case";
return 0;
}
複製代碼
歡迎光臨 種子論壇 | 高雄市資訊培育協會學員討論區 (http://seed.istak.org.tw/)
Powered by Discuz! 7.2